Transaction 7c306c1b3eeeaf8496449797f23c1c61101b98ab58a64ea6be28d8672c08d08f
1 Input
1 Output
-
7c306c1b3eeeaf8496449797f23c1c61101b98ab58a64ea6be28d8672c08d08f:0
- value
- 7675060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40a33958ef04808f7f7f6007ef4172f21b7ad50e OP_EQUAL
- address
- 37anhpkjuXqFWe6ceJc8ihL2VhgkPb3MPY